Output 3bec25125ce6bc31959992b2e68bc162a204bb15c54844f62fd2fd06da28d629:4

value
3855493
script pubkey
OP_0 OP_PUSHBYTES_20 846a26e044cdacf26d315e8e0bcd2bbba4038e08
address
bc1qs34zdczyekk0ymf3t68qhnfthwjq8rsgae9epg
transaction
3bec25125ce6bc31959992b2e68bc162a204bb15c54844f62fd2fd06da28d629
confirmations
275137
spent
true